Szpakowska et al. also studied conolidone and its action about the ACKR3 receptor, which aids to clarify its Earlier not known mechanism of action in both of those acute and chronic pain Handle (58). It was observed that receptor amounts of ACKR3 ended up as substantial or simply bigger as those of the endogenous opiate method and have been correlated to similar parts of the CNS. This receptor was also not modulated by traditional opiate agonists, which includes morphine, fentanyl, buprenorphine, or antagonists like naloxone. In a rat model, it had been uncovered that a competitor molecule binding to ACKR3 resulted in inhibition of ACKR3’s inhibitory action, causing an Total rise in opiate receptor exercise.
